Health Committee: interim orderOn Thursday 15 November 2007 the Health Committee of the Royal Pharmaceutical Society of Great Britain made an order under article 51 of the Pharmacists and Pharmacy Technicians Order 2007, that for a period of 18 months the registration of Mohammad Atif Yousaf (registration number 93328) shall be conditional upon his compliance with the following requirements: to notify all employers (including the superintendent pharmacist or responsible pharmacist) or contractors, all prospective employers (including the superintendent pharmacist or responsible pharmacist) or contractors, agents acting on behalf of employers, whether for paid or voluntary employment for which registration with the Society is required (in the UK or elsewhere), of the matters under consideration by the Society/the conditions in this Order. In the case of prospective employers, this notification must be given at the time of application; to keep professional commitments under review; not to work as a superintendent pharmacist, responsible pharmacist or single handed practitioner; not to undertake any pharmacy practice as a locum; not to undertake on-call duties, weekend work, out-of-hours work, or extended-hours work. This order is subject to review within 12 months. Fitness to Practise Committees Secretariat |
